KazNARU Hosts Regular Cleanup Day as Part of "Clean Kazakhstan" Campaign
The Kazakh National Agrarian Research University (KazNARU) recently held a community cleanup day, actively engaging staff, faculty, and students in support of the nationwide ecological initiative, “Clean Kazakhstan,” launched by President Kassym-Jomart Tokayev. The event was organized in line with the university leadership’s approved plan.
Autumn, a season when nature rests and is painted in golden hues, calls for extra care for the environment. The cleanup day aimed to foster environmental awareness, improve the university grounds, and strengthen ecological culture among the university community.
Over 500 participants, including administrative staff, professors, and students, joined the effort. They were fully equipped with shovels, rakes, buckets, gloves, and other necessary tools. Together, they cleaned areas in front of academic buildings and dormitories, maintained flowerbeds, cleared courtyards across all faculties, and tidied the Central Stadium and landscaped zones. Dry branches and fallen leaves were collected and removed, leaving the campus refreshed and well-kept.
“This event is a chance for our community to contribute to a cleaner, greener campus,” said KazNARU representatives. “By working together, we enhance our surroundings and promote environmental responsibility.”
